Security
Flush casement windows differ from traditional sash windows that consist of two frames that are stacked one on top of the other. When closed, they have a single frame which sits directly on the surface of the window. They are designed to resemble original timber sash window appearance while meeting modern thermal efficiency requirements and security.
They provide a higher level of security because of their design. They are able to achieve the PAS24 certification and also have a useful locking position for the night vent. The uPVC frames have a double rebated timber-weld joint which prevents bonding and provides a more modern look.
They also have concealed hardware to reduce the risk of draughts and other issues. This allows them to maintain a the highest standards of energy efficiency throughout the home, meaning that homeowners across Kent can enjoy reduced heating costs and a more comfortable living space.

Maintenance
In contrast to conventional casement windows that finish flush with the outside of the frame, flush sash window frames create a sleeker aesthetic. They are not just beautiful but also offer energy efficiency, security, and maintenance benefits that make a difference to any home.

It doesn't matter if you live in a rustic cottage in Leicestershire or a modern townhouse close to Nottingham or Derby The flush-sash windows seamlessly blend into the design aesthetic of your home. The slim sightlines of these windows are designed in a way to minimise bumps and lumps.
They are simple to maintain, as they require very little upkeep apart from a few wipes down to keep them looking like new. However, to boost their longevity and performance homeowners should ensure that they lubricate the hardware on their flush sash windows. This includes handles, hinges and locking mechanisms to prevent rusting and ensure they work efficiently.
It is important to clean your flush sash window regularly to get rid of dirt, grime and other contaminates that could impact the appearance and function of your home. This can be done both on the inside and outside of the window, and it's also a good idea to look for signs of damage that may need repair.
